Question
which cell junction allows the flow of ions between cells?
desmosome
gap junction
tight junction

Brief Explanations
Gap junctions are composed of connexons that form channels between cells, allowing the passage of ions and small - molecule substances for intercellular communication. Desmosomes are for cell - cell adhesion, and tight junctions seal cells together to prevent paracellular transport.
